Пожалуйста, чтобы помочь мне подключиться удаленно к базе данных Firebird 3.0 на Ubuntu 14.04. Я устанавливаю этот сервер Firebird 3.0 из официальной инструкции Ubuntu. Ive получил Flamerobin, и я могу подключиться и создать форму базы данных Flamerobin, когда база данных локализации - localhost. Все нормально.
Но когда я хочу подключиться с другого компьютера в той же сети или в Flamerobin в этом Ubuntu, я выбираю IP-адрес этого компьютера, я не могу подключиться, и я вижу это сообщение (ниже ):
* IBPP :: SQLException * Контекст: База данных :: Сообщение Connect: isc_attach_database failed
Сообщение SQL: -902 Неудачное выполнение, вызванное системной ошибкой, которая исключает успешное выполнение последующих statements
Код двигателя: 335544721 Сообщение двигателя: Не удается выполнить сетевой запрос к хосту «192.168.2.101». Не удалось установить соединение.
В firebird.conf я делаю RemoteServicePort = 3050 и RemoteBindAddress =
Я пытаюсь разблокировать все 3050 портов на iptables, но он все еще не работает. [ ! d7]
Regard Robert
Изменить: Теперь мои iptables:
admin @ ubuntu-hd: ~ $ sudo iptables -L Цепочка INPUT (политика ACCEPT) target prot opt источник назначения ACCEPT все - везде где-нибудь ctstate RELATED, ESTABLISHED ACCEPT tcp - где угодно
Цепочка FORWARD (политика ACCEPT) целевая цель opt opt ACCEPT tcp - где угодно [ ! d12]
Цепь OUTPUT (политика ACCEPT) target target opt source destination ACCEPT tcp - где угодно
Но соединение по-прежнему отклонено